jazz guitarist Ged Brockie jazz guitarist Ged Brockie SCOTTISH GUITAR QUARTET ALBUMS Landmarks - Circular CR1006: more info  A landmark recording with seminal producer Calum Malcolm. SGQ built on the success of their previous work with five star reviews throughout Europe for Landmarks. Numerous performances in Germany and Austria as well as across the UK were the result.  Fait Accompli - Circular CR1001: more info  Recorded amid a hectic touring schedule which included N.Ireland and Eire, SGQ recorded this 2002 album at the illustrious Old School House studio in Pencaitland. This release established the band not only within the UK, but Germany and Austria. Near The Circle - Circular CR1000: more info  Originally released on the now defunct “Caber” label, this first recording in 2000 laid the foundations of the music that would begin to show itself over the next six years. Raw in production, but exciting in concept, Near The Circle received excellent reviews.  A Different Point of View - Acoustic Music Records: more info  This album is a compilation of favourite pieces from the above three albums distributed initially in Germany by virtuoso solo guitarist Peter Finger.
